Learn to play ZZ Top's " La Grange" on 3 string cigar box guitar, with Chickenbone John

Here's a one chord favourite of mine, based on John Lee Hooker's one chord boogie style - La Grange by ZZ Top. The important thing is the rhythm, and it is vital to get that driving beat - if you've followed my blues shuffle videos, this should be a fairly natural progression. It's pretty repetitive, and the key is to nail that beat as a bedrock foundation so that you can embellished it with rhythmical and melodic flourishes. You don't need to move up and down the fretboard much, and indeed the secret is to keep in pretty much the one position with the left hand, we won't go much outside the 3rd and 5th frets for the whole number. Economy of movement with the fretting hand is what it's all about.
